Imagine you went to a restaurant with a date;had a burger,paid with a credit card,and left.The next time you go there,the waiter or waitress,armed with your profile data,greets you with,“Hey Joe,how are you? Mary is over there in the seat you sat last time.Would you like to join her for dinner again?” Then you find out that your burger has been cooked and placed on the table.Forget the fact that you are with another date and are on a diet that doesn’t include burgers.
Sound a 1ittle bizarre? To some。this is the restaurant equivalent of the Internet.The Net’s ability to profile you through your visits to and interactions at websites provides marketers with an enormous amount of data on you——some of which you may not want them to have.
Are you aware that almost every time you access a website you get a“
cookie
”?Unfortunately,it’s not the Mrs.Field’s recipe.A cookie on the Internet is a computer code sent by the site to your computer——usually without your knowledge.During the entire period of time that you are at the site,the cookie is collecting information about yourself,including where you visit,how long you stay there,and how frequently you return to certain pages.
While this may sound scary enough,cookies aren’t even the latest in technology.A new system call I-librarian Alexa——named after the legendary third century B.C.library in Alexandria,Egypt——does even more.While cookies track what you are doing at one site.Alexa collects data on all your web activities,such as which site you visit next,how long you stay there,whether you click on advertisements,etc.All this information is available to marketers,who use it to market more effectively to you.Not only do you not get paid for providing the information,you probably don’t even know that you are giving it.
In the restaurant story,the author may most probably think the waiter or waitress was__________.
选项
A、stupid
B、polite
C、considerate
D、annoying
答案
D
解析
推断题。根据第一段中的“Forget the fact that you are with another date and are on a diet that doesn’t include burgers.(忘掉你和另一个约会对象的事实,你正在节食,所以不吃汉堡。)”以及第一段其他内容的描述可以推断出作者对这种做法的态度是负面的。四个选项中,B项“有礼貌的”和C项“体贴的”属于积极意义的词汇,不符合文意,故排除。A项“愚蠢的”和D项“令人讨厌的”相比,“令人讨厌的”更加符合作者当时的心情。故本题选D。
